This video (after the screenshots) shows the ‘growing’ of a Gravity Stool by by Jólan van der Wiel, and directed  by Miranda Stet. These stools are totally unique and it’s fascinating to see how they’re made.

The Gravity Stool thanks its unique shape to the cooperation between magnetic fields and the power of gravity. Departing from the idea that everything is influenced by gravitation, a force that has a strongly shaping effect, Jólan intended to manipulate this natural phenomenon by exploiting its own power: magnetism. The positioning of the magnetic fields in the machine, opposing each other, has largely determined the final shape of the Gravity Stool.
